When seventeen-year-old Aria Chen’s world crumbles in a single morning—divorce papers, cheating boyfriends, and a supernatural storm that tears through her high school bathroom—she discovers that some breakdowns are actually breakthroughs.
Whisked away to Aethermoor Academy, a hidden school for those with elemental gifts, Aria thinks she’s finally found where she belongs. But one drugged drink and a passionate night with a brooding werewolf later, she’s thrust into a world of magical politics, dangerous enemies, and three supernatural guardians who may be more than she bargained for.
Between mastering her storm magic and navigating the treacherous social hierarchies of magical society, Aria must learn to trust her power—and her heart—before her past catches up with her and her newfound family tears itself apart.
Some storms destroy everything in their path. Others clear the way for something beautiful to grow.
